Civil Servant Denies Allegations of Conditioning the Winner of the Public School Construction Tender

MY INFO, BLORA – Finally , an employee of the Blora Housing, Settlements, and Transportation Agency (Dinrumkimhub) denied allegations of involvement in conditioning and the alleged giving of Rp. 300 thousand in connection with the winning partner for the tender for the construction of the People's School.

Head of the Traffic Section of the Blora Transportation Agency, Setiyono, explained that his meeting with the partner happened by chance.

He admitted that he had known the partner since 2016 when they met on a transportation route in the Cepu area.

"Then we met again at the SlapaJaz cafe. My colleague asked me for help because he was receiving calls from the Blora media. I then contacted someone known to the media," he explained to the press.

Setiyono admitted that he was not aware of the giving of money as alleged, including the nominal amount of IDR 300 thousand.

The money is given directly from the partners and media.

"I don't know and have never managed the use of the money and I don't know the nominal amount either," he explained .

He said the meeting with the partner took place outside of working hours.

The meeting took place on Friday night at SlapaJaz Cafe.

“Friday night at SlapaJaz at 9:00 p.m.,” he said.

Setiyono apologized if the issue caused unrest in the community.

He hopes that this issue can be viewed based on facts and statements from each party.

Previously, activist Lilik Yuliantoro alias Mat Tohek walked back towards the prosecutor's office and the Blora DPRD.

He requested that the matter be followed up firmly, if violations were found to have been committed by the ASN with the initials STY and reported to the prosecutor's office.

"What we're asking for is simple: if there are violations, don't cover them up. Civil servants found to have violated the law must be sanctioned, and contractors must also have the courage to provide clarification and apologize to the public," he said.

Apart from the alleged involvement of ASN, Lilik also highlighted the alleged giving of Rp. 300 thousand.

According to him, this issue needs to be investigated further to determine the actual facts. (Endah/ IST )
